Myanmar pardons 7 foreign prisoners on Armed Forces Day

YANGON, March 27 (Xinhua) -- Myanmar's State Administration Council pardoned seven foreign prisoners on the country's 80th anniversary of Armed Forces Day on Thursday.

According to the council's order, the pardoned prisoners included four Thai nationals from Kawthoung prison and three Philippine nationals from Hpa-an prison.

The prisoners were pardoned in consideration of friendly relations among the countries and on humanitarian grounds, the council said.

The prisoners were pardoned and expelled under the condition that they will serve the remainder of their reduced sentences if they commit crimes again, it added.
